And from the last link some detail that I am interested in:

New in JavaScript 1.8.1

************************EXCERPT************************

JavaScript 1.8.1 is a modest update syntactically to JavaScript; the main change in this release is the addition of the Tracemonkey just-in-time compiler, which improves performance.

All my Firefox browsers (FF-2, 3.1) have had one problem: When I click on a news video from a TV station, they almost always don't work and I have to view with IE-6. I have shut off Adblock and NoScript but they still don't run. I suspect the 15-second ads most stations run before a news video are being blocked which means the following video of interest never plays either. No problem with YouTube or other internet video. Any ideas??
